Household of Elisabeth Oosterbosch

(1) She is married to Lucas Janssen.

They got married on October 2, 1740 at Oerle.Source 1

They were married in church on October 2, 1740 at Wintelre.Source 1


Child(ren):

  1. Theodorus Janssen  1740-????
  2. Petronella Janssen  1742-????
  3. Catharina Janssen  1746-????
  4. Theodora Janssen  1750-????


(2) She is married to Leonardus Heijmans.

They got married on June 17, 1759 at Vessem.Source 1

They were married in church on June 17, 1759 at Wintelre.Source 1
